Andress gets skewered for flubbing anthem.

Monday, July 15, 2024 – Ingrid Andress received the honor of singing the National Anthem before Major League Baseball's Home Run Derby tonight.

Only based on how it went down, she just be wishing she hadn't agreed to it.

Andress was accused of singing off key in an idiosynchratic take on the song. She also sounded a bit shrill at times.

Several baseball players gave amused looks as Andress sang.
